Twelve senior officers of Income Tax Department were compulsorily retired by the government.
Sources said, the action by the Finance Ministry was taken on charges of corruption and professional misconduct against them.
The list is topped by a Joint Commissioner rank officer against whom there are serious complaints of corruption and extortion from businessmen accused of helping self-styled godman Chandraswami.
It also includes an IRS officer in the post of Commissioner (Appeal) in Noida, who was accused of sexual harassment to two two women IRS officers of Commissioner rank.
Another IRS officer who compulsory retired had acquired movable and immovable assets worth over three crore rupees in the name of self and his family members.
